Understanding Side Airbags


Side airbags are designed to deploy in the event of a side collision, providing additional protection to the torso and head of the occupants. They are typically located in the side of the seat or the door panel and can significantly reduce the risk of injury during an accident.


Ford F-150 Airbag Features


As of the latest models, the Ford F-150 does indeed come equipped with side airbags. Here are some key points regarding the airbag system in the F-150:



  • Standard Equipment: Most recent models of the F-150 include side airbags as standard equipment, enhancing the overall safety profile of the vehicle.

  • Advanced Safety Technology: In addition to side airbags, the F-150 is often equipped with other advanced safety features such as curtain airbags, which provide additional protection for passengers in the event of a rollover.

  • Crash Test Ratings: The F-150 has received high safety ratings from various testing organizations, which often take into account the effectiveness of side airbags in protecting occupants.

How common are side airbags?


Only driver and front-passenger airbags are required in cars, but almost all models also come with front-seat side airbags and side curtain airbags because they help carmakers meet federal requirements for protecting passengers in a side-impact crash.



Are side airbags worth it?


A head-protecting side airbag is particularly important because it may be the only thing between the occupant's head and the striking vehicle, since window glass can shatter in a crash.
